<!DOCTYPE html>
1. Know Your Audience
The first step to creating a successful iOS game is understanding who your target audience is. You need to know what they like and dislike, their age range, their interests, and their level of gaming experience. This information will help you design a game that appeals to them and meets their expectations. For instance, if your target audience consists of children aged 6-12, you should create a game that is fun, engaging, and easy to understand.
2. Focus on Gameplay Mechanics
The gameplay mechanics of your game are one of the most critical factors that determine its success. You need to make sure that your game is intuitive, challenging, and enjoyable to play. It’s essential to test your game thoroughly to ensure that it’s bug-free and runs smoothly on different devices. Additionally, you should consider incorporating unique gameplay mechanics that set your game apart from the competition.
3. Optimize Your Game for Performance
One of the biggest challenges faced by iOS game developers is optimizing their games for performance. You need to ensure that your game runs smoothly on all devices, regardless of their specifications. This involves minimizing load times, reducing resource usage, and avoiding any unnecessary animations or effects that could slow down the game.
4. Use Social Media to Promote Your Game
Social media is an excellent tool for promoting your game and reaching a wider audience. You can use social media platforms like Facebook, Twitter, Instagram, and LinkedIn to share updates about your game, engage with your fans, and build a community around your brand. It’s also important to use relevant hashtags and join gaming communities where you can showcase your game and get valuable feedback.
5. Utilize In-App Purchases
In-app purchases are a great way to monetize your game and generate revenue. However, you need to be careful about how you implement them in your game. You should avoid overwhelming players with too many purchase options or making them feel pressured to buy things they don’t need. Instead, offer value-added content that enhances the player experience and provides additional levels of engagement.
6. Stay Up-to-Date with Industry Trends
The gaming industry is constantly evolving, and it’s essential to stay up-to-date with the latest trends and technologies. This includes keeping an eye on new game engines, tools, and frameworks that can help you create better games more efficiently. You should also follow industry experts and thought leaders who share valuable insights and advice on game development.
7. Test and Iterate
Finally, one of the most important things you can do as an iOS game developer is to test your game thoroughly and iterate based on user feedback. You should test your game on different devices and operating systems to ensure that it works seamlessly and identify any bugs or issues that need to be addressed. Additionally, you should actively seek out user feedback and incorporate it into the development process to create a better player experience.
FAQs
1. What are some of the most popular game engines for iOS game development?
Some of the most popular game engines for iOS game development include Unity, Unreal Engine, and Xcode.
2. How can I monetize my iOS game?
There are several ways to monetize your iOS game, including in-app purchases, ads, subscriptions, and physical goods. You should choose the best monetization strategy that aligns with your game’s goals and target audience.
3. How do I optimize my game for performance on different devices?
To optimize your game for performance on different devices, you need to minimize load times, reduce resource usage, and avoid unnecessary animations or effects. You should also test your game thoroughly on different devices to ensure that it runs smoothly.
4. What are some of the most important metrics to track when developing an iOS game?
Some of the most important metrics to track when developing an iOS game include user engagement, retention rate, and conversion rate. You should monitor these metrics regularly to identify areas for improvement and make data-driven decisions.
Summary
In conclusion, becoming a successful iOS game developer requires a combination of skills, knowledge, and hard work. By following the tips outlined in this article, you can create a game that appeals to your target audience, optimizes performance, and generates revenue. Remember to stay up-to-date with industry trends, test and iterate based on user feedback, and utilize social media to promote your game and build a community around your brand. With these tips in mind, you’re well on your way to achieving success in the world of iOS game development.